Killing Eve reveals series three will drop in the US TWO WEEKS earlier than planned as they unveil explosive new trailer… while UK release date still remains unknown

Killing Eve has announced that series three will drop in the US two weeks earlier than planned on BBC America.

The hit thriller took to its Twitter to reveal that the third season will now debut on Sunday April 12 as they unveiled a new explosive trailer.

Yet British viewers were left disappointed by the news as a UK release date still remains unknown, with fans speculating it could be June.

Killing Eve tweeted: ‘Ahhhhhhhhhhh. #KillingEve returns two weeks early, Sunday, April 12 at 9pm on @BBCAmerica and @AMC_TV.’

The programme also posted a new explosive first look at series three, which saw Eve Polastri alive and well after she was left for dead in series two.
